Deploy step 4: enable the Formula sandbox on Calcwright. User-supplied formulas now execute inside the Hollowbox runtime with no filesystem or network access. Verify the sandbox image tag matches the release manifest before promoting. Evaluation requests are brokered by the Tallis gateway, which rejects any call not bearing a valid broker credential. Roll pods one at a time; a bad credential fails closed and formulas return errors instead of results. Add this line to the gateway env file:

env line for fafof-fahag: LEDGER_TOKEN5=f8790

CI note: pagination failures on the Lanternkey public API

The nightly contract suite against Lanternkey v3 intermittently fails on the `/listings` endpoint when a page boundary lands exactly on a deleted record. The cursor then points at a tombstone and the next fetch returns an empty page with `has_more: true`, which the test treats as a hang. Re-run with the tombstone-skip flag before escalating. For correlation, attach the failing run's trace token, reproduced below.

pipeline stamp: htk6_35e0c9

**02:14** — Nightly search reindex on the Quillhaven cluster began as scheduled. At 02:31 the indexer stalled on a malformed document batch from the catalog feed and began retrying in a tight loop, saturating one shard's write queue. Alerting did not fire because retry errors were classified as warnings. On-call should note that the stall is only visible in the indexer's own logs, not the cluster dashboard. The indexer build involved in this incident is recorded below.

trace token, fafog-kageg: htk4_98e6

Leadership Review Briefing — Second-Source Supplier Search

Branch managers: Quillard Fabrication remains our sole supplier of the Averno valve assembly, creating delivery risk. Procurement has shortlisted three alternative vendors and begun sample qualification at the Dunbray plant. Trials conclude next quarter; no changes to current ordering procedures until then. The confidential note below outlines the dual-sourcing plan.

internal memo for kawip-hadug: Headcount on the Wenwyn team goes from 7 to 140 by the end of January. Gross margin on Wenwyn came in at 20 percent against a plan of 15 percent.